She arrived at the edge of their marriage and made herself indispensable. That was the plan. It worked better than expected.
Sharna Taylor is the most effective operative in the series-not because she carries a weapon, but because she reads people the way a diagnostician reads symptoms. She sees GW Canyon's need for steadiness and Tali Canyon's need for surrender, and she builds a strategy around both. What she doesn't account for is the journal she keeps. Or what happens when someone reads it.
Set across the American West-canyon country, flathead lake, the high desert, a marriage under pressure-Watershed is the GW Canyon series at its most intimate. Tali in therapy, working to understand the architecture of her own compliance. GW, for once, not at the center of a crisis but at the edge of one he created. And Sharna, whose final diary entry may be the most honest document in the series.
A novel about the women we let in, the damage we don't see, and the particular intelligence it takes to rebuild.
For readers of Tana French and Sally Rooney-who understand that the most devastating things are usually said in private, and written down.
Book 3 of the GW Canyon Journey series. Stands alone. Best after Book 2.
